EPA at 50 logoEPA's Homeland Security Research Program provides science and technology needed to effectively respond to and recover from  disasters. Natural disasters and man-made disasters, whether intentional or unintentional, can result in contamination that threatens human health, the environment, and our economy. Communities must be resilient to avoid such catastrophes. Resilience requires scientific information to support good decisions.
